Cooperation ministry signs MoU to enable primary agricultural credit societies
In order to enable Primary Agricultural Credit Societies (PACS) and provide services offered by Common Service Centres, CSCs, A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) was signed between the Ministry of Cooperation, the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ology, NABARD and CSC e-Governance Services India Limited in New Delhi.
- Primary Agricultural Credit Societies are the soul of cooperatives and making them multipurpose as providers of about 20 services will increase employment opportunities in rural areas.
First Tourism Working Group Meeting to be held in Gujarat from February 7
The first Tourism Working Group (TWG) Meeting will be held at Dhordo in Rann of Kutch in Gujarat between the 7th and 9th of February 2023. Union Minister of Tourism G. Kishan Reddy, Union Minister of Fisheries, Animal Husbandry and Dairying Parshottam Rupala, and Gujarat Chief Minister Bhupendra Patel will participate in the inaugural session of the meeting on February 8th, 2023.
- The meeting will focus on five priority areas including Green Tourism, Digitalization, Skills, Tourism MSMEs, and Destination Management.
Mahanadi Coalfields Ltd introduces VIHANGAM Drone Technology and Latest Safety Equipment
Mahanadi Coalfields Ltd (MCL) introduced drone technology in coal mines by launching a web-based portal VIHANGAM along with a drone and ground control system. The portal “VIHANGAM” aims to allow an authorised person to access real-time drone video from the mine through a dedicated 40 Mbps internet lease line near the mines. This pilot project is at present operational at Bhubaneswari and Lingraj opencast mines of Talcher Coalfields.

Asia’s first floating festival commenced on February 1
Gandhisagar Floating Festival, touted as Asia’s first floating festival, was started on February 1 at Mandsaur, Madhya Pradesh. The first edition of the five-day floating festival has been inaugurated by Usha Thakur, Minister of Tourism, Culture and Religious Trust and Endowments, Government of Madhya Pradesh. It aims to offer a unique glamping and adventure experience to the tourists visiting Mandsaur, Madhya Pradesh,” Madhya Pradesh Tourism wrote, sharing that the festival commenced with “the auspicious performances of Indian Ocean rock band” on February 1.
- Gandhisagar Floating Festival can also explore nearby places, including Buddhist Caves, Chaturbhuj Nala, Gandhisagar Sanctuary, Mandsaur Fort, Neemuch, Dharmarajeshwar Temple, and Pashupatinath Temple.
Department of Youth Affairs to conduct Youth 20 Summit inception meeting from 6th to 8th February at Guwahati
Department of Youth Affairs is going to organize Youth 20 Summit-2023 from the 6th to the 8th of February 2023 at Guwahati, Assam Under the framework of the G20 Presidency. Youth20 is one of the official Engagement Groups of the G20. The Youth20 (Y20) Engagement Group will arrange discussions pan-India, to consult the youth of the nation on ideas for a better tomorrow and draft an agenda for action. Y20 will also help in providing a platform for youth to express their perspectives and ideas on G20 priorities.
The five Y20 themes are:
- Future of Work: Industry 4.0, Innovation, & 21st Century Skills
- Climate Change and Disaster Risk Reduction: Making Sustainability a Way of Life
- Peacebuilding and Reconciliation: Ushering in an Era of No War
- Shared Future: Youth in Democracy and Governance
- Health, Well-being & Sports: Agenda for Youth

Manjit Singh Saini becomes the next Director (P&A) of Shipping Corporation of India (SCI)
Manjit Singh Saini has been appointed as the next Director (P&A) of the Shipping Corporation of India (SCI), a PSU under the Ministry of Shipping. at present, he is serving as General Manager in the same organization. Manjit Singh Saini will play a role in maintaining smooth industrial relations, administration and development of human resources of the company.
Prashant Agrawal appointed as the next Ambassador of India to Laos
The Ministry of External Affairs appointed Prashant Agrawal as the next Ambassador of India to Laos. at present, Prashant Agrawal is serving as High Commissioner of India to Namibia. prior to this, he served in India’s Missions in Paris, Port Louis and Bangkok where he served as Deputy Chief of Mission and India’s Deputy Permanent Representative to UNESCAP.

SpaceX successfully launched the 53 Starlink satellites in space
SpaceX successfully launched the 53 Starlink satellite on the milestone 200th Falcon 9 rocket flight lit up on 2nd February 2023, to low-Earth orbit from NASA’s Kennedy Space Center. Starlink satellites offer broadband internet in remote and rural locations.

South Asian Women’s Football Tournament 2023
The South Asian Under-20 Women’s Football Championship is being conducted in Bangladesh’s capital, Dhaka, from February 3 to 9, 2023. Bangladesh, India, Bhutan and Nepal are participating in this tournament. on the first day of the tournament, India-Bhutan and Bangladesh-Nepal teams will play matches.

World Cancer Day 2023
Every year, World Cancer Day is observed on 4th February across the world. the initiative is led by the Union for International Cancer Control (UICC).
- The main purpose of World Cancer Day is to prevent millions of deaths each year by creating more awareness and offering education about cancer and pressing governments and individuals across the world to take action against the disease.
- The theme of World Cancer Day 2023 is “Close the Care Gap” and it’s observed from 2022-2024.
